  • How is that omni directional?

    It only goes forward and turns.

    You can get that with 2 (non-omni) wheels and 0-4 casters for balance (0 being like a segway)

    I'd like to see it move sideways, which I assume it should be able to do with the right programming.

  • We lathed out some HDPE and cut acrylic tubing to size. We then glued on bicycle tire tubing over top of the tubing. We have made several types of these wheels. These were the heaviest by far. Our team couldn't use them because of the weight, but we sure had some fun playing with them!
